Full-time Security Guard Agreement: This type of agreement involves hiring security guards to work on a full-time basis at the plant or manufacturing facility. These guards are responsible for monitoring access points, patrolling the premises, and responding to any security incidents or emergencies. 2. Part-time Security Guard Agreement: In some cases, plant or manufacturing facilities may require security guards on a part-time basis. This agreement specifies the number of hours per day or week the security guards will work and outlines their duties and responsibilities. 3. Temporary Security Guard Agreement: When there is a need for short-term security services at a plant or manufacturing facility, a temporary security guard agreement can be arranged. This agreement specifies the duration of service required, such as during special events, seasonal demands, or construction projects. 4. Armed Security Guard Agreement: Some plant or manufacturing facilities may require armed security guards due to the nature of the business or the value of the assets involved. This agreement outlines the qualifications and responsibilities of armed security guards and ensures compliance with legal requirements and regulations regarding the use of firearms. 5. Surveillance and Alarm Monitoring Agreement: In addition to security guards, plant or manufacturing facilities may require surveillance systems and alarm monitoring services. This agreement covers the installation, maintenance, and monitoring of CCTV cameras, access control systems, and alarms to enhance security measures. In the Suffolk New York Agreement to Furnish Plant or Manufacturing Facility with Security Guards, key details typically covered include the scope of services, working hours, rates and payment terms, insurance and liability coverage, termination clauses, and any specific requirements or expectations unique to the plant or manufacturing facility.
